Key Features of the Student Visitor Incident Report Form
Essential elements of the Student Visitor Incident Report Form include several crucial fields that must be completed. The form requires information such as:
-
Date and time of the incident
-
Location where the incident occurred
-
A detailed description of the incident
-
Witness information
-
Medical treatment details, if applicable
These features ensure that every important aspect of the incident is captured, facilitating better understanding and response.

Who is eligible to fill out the Student Visitor Incident Report Form?
The form is meant for any University of Houston student or visitor involved in an incident on campus. Additionally, university staff may fill it out on behalf of individuals who cannot.
What information do I need to complete the form?
You will need the date, time, and location of the incident, along with a detailed description of what happened. Also, gather information about any witnesses and medical treatment received, if applicable.
How do I submit the completed form?
After completing the form on pdfFiller, you can submit it by emailing it to the Environmental Health and Safety Office or following your institution's guidelines for submission.
Are there any deadlines for submitting the Student Visitor Incident Report Form?
Deadlines for submission can vary depending on the nature of the incident and university policies. It's advisable to submit the form as soon as possible after the incident to ensure timely review.
What should I avoid when completing the form?
Common mistakes include leaving fields blank, providing inaccurate information, or failing to follow submission instructions. Always double-check your entries for accuracy.
How long does it take for an incident report to be processed?
Processing times for incident reports can vary. Generally, it may take a few days to a week, depending on the nature of the incident and the internal review procedures.
Is notarization required for this form?
No, notarization is not required for the Student Visitor Incident Report Form, simplifying the submission process.
